A Paramagnetic μ‐Methylene Complex with a Short CrIIICrIII Bond

Seok Kyun Noh、Robert A. Heintz、Christoph Janiak 等 5 位作者1990-07-01Angewandte Chemie International Edition in English

A CrCr distance of only 2.394(1) Å was found in the binuclear complex 2, obtainable by decomposition of 1. Extended Hückel calculations gave five energetically similar frontier orbitals for six electrons. The high magnetic moment (μeff = 3.3μB) indicates the presence of a CrCr single bond.
